Franchise Tax / 05-102 Texas Franchise Tax Public Information Report WebThe TX sales tax rate is 6.25 percent statewide. Local taxing jurisdictions, such as cities and counties, may also impose sales tax at a rate of up to 2 percent for a total maximum combined rate of 8.25 percent.
